I went back and forth on how I felt on this one. The main character frustrated the hell out of me. However, I remembered back to a time when I was her age and how things were never black and white in terms of romantic relations. I think this is an important read for the YA group because the reactions from people because of her actions were very real. Also, I like that it demonstrated the sorts of things boys will try to do to girls and how the girls will receive the backlash and labeling. So, while I wasn't the biggest fan of the main character and her choices, I still appreciated the overall story and message. And, also, if her mother was my mother... there are no words for how I would react to her publishing my life!
